検索キーワードを入力:

wordpress:ドメインの変更時のDBの書き換え

生きてます。長らく更新していませんでしたが、ご質問をいただいたりして、こんな覚え書きでも見る人が居るのかと思わされました。
仕事もちゃんとしてます。
今回は運営しているサイトのドメインを変更した時にデーターベースの書き換えをちょこっとやったので、覚え書き。

用意するもの

  1. 古いドメイン(古いURL)
  2. 新しいドメイン(新しいURL)
  3. SQL

サイトによって様々だと思いますが、書き換えるところをきちんと把握出来てたら満点です。今回の僕のやったお引っ越しでは、以下を書き換え対象にしました。

  • wp-posts内のpost_content -記事の中の画像URLや自サイト内のリンク等の書き換え(記事内)
  • wp-posts内のguid -画像などのメディアアップロード時のメディアURL
  • wp_options内のoption_value -サイトURLやHOMEURLやプラグインで指定したURL情報など

もちろん以上はウチの場合なので、これ以外にも必要になるサイトもあると思います。
実行するのは以下
[sourcecode language=”sql”]
update wp_posts set post_content=replace(post_content,’古いURL’,’新しいURL’)
update wp_posts set guid=replace(guid,’古いURL’,’新しいURL’)
update wp_options set option_value=replace(option_value,’古いURL’,’新しいURL’)
[/sourcecode]
ここで注意
[note]
wp_postsやwp_optionsは、データベースに応じて書き換えて下さい。wordpressインストール時に設定した接頭語に応じて違ってきます。
[/note]

About Little

WordPressをいじくり倒して早10年。一人ぼっちでひたすらソースとにらめっこ厨。 有り難いことに、Welcart/WP e-commerce/WooCommerce/EC-Cube等で多数ECサイトを制作させていただいたけど、ふと気付いた、ちゃんと売れるのか。 効果的に売れるようにするためにはどうしたらいいのか。ということでお勉強を兼ねてECサイトも運営中。
2009年9月25日

Related Posts

4 comments found

Comments for: wordpress:ドメインの変更時のDBの書き換え

  1. Pingback: [Tips] WordPressを引っ越す時の手続き | ブログ | ちゃんとWebなホームページ制作会社(東京) エイチツーオー・スペース[H2O Space.]

  2. Pingback: WordPressのドメイン(URL)、タイトルを変更 | shoutack/blog

  3. Pingback: j-inb.net » WordPressのドメイン変更

  4. Pingback: テヌミチ - URL変更に伴う画像表示が出来ない問題を修正しました

コメントを残す

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です